Ingredients
Method
Start the emulsion
- Bring the egg to room temperature (about 20 minutes out of the fridge). Combine egg, mustard, lemon juice and salt in a bowl.
- Whisk until uniform. Have the oil ready in a jug with a fine spout.
Add the oil
- Add oil drop by drop while whisking vigorously until the mixture thickens and turns pale (the first tablespoon is critical).
- Once thick, add the remaining oil in a thin steady stream, whisking the whole time, until all the oil is incorporated and the mayonnaise stands in soft peaks.
- Taste and adjust lemon and salt. If too thick, whisk in 1 teaspoon of cold water.
Serving
Use as a spread, dip base, or dressing. Bring to cool room temperature for easier spreading if very thick from the fridge.
Storage
Refrigerate in a clean jar up to 3 days. Do not leave at room temperature more than 2 hours. Do not freeze.
